I also spent some time thinking about my intentions for this batch. At the start of my last batch I had rigid ideas about what I'd work on and what I wanted to achieve. When I started following my curiosity, pair programming more, letting go of what I thought I "should" do, and embracing serendipity my batch improved a LOT: I learnt lots of new things, wrote code that I wouldn't have been able to write before, had a lot more fun, and felt more content & relaxed.

So I'm going to avoid planning too much, and see what I feel like working on day by day or week by week. I do have a list of potential fun project ideas, but I'm going to try to use it more as inspiration or backup. I'll try setting some time aside each week to reflect and possibly make adjustments.

There are a couple of overarching things I'd like to do during my batch: make the most of being in such a great collaborative environment, and work in public more. So I'll probably try to pair program quite a bit, and blog more.
